Per-bed prices

Bed assembly prices in Knightsbridge

Priced per bed and fixed before we arrive. The van, the tools, Westminster City Council permits, ULEZ, the Congestion Charge and taking the packaging away are already inside every figure.
  • Ottoman bed, double gas strut or side-lift

    £110 – £170

    2 hrs 10 mins

    Strut rating matched to the mattress weight, base tested loaded before we leave the room

  • Ottoman bed, single gas strut

    £85 – £130

    1 hr 40 mins

    Struts fitted last and balanced so the lid holds mid-lift instead of sinking on the mattress

  • Single or double bed frame (wood or metal)

    £45 – £75

    55 mins

    Centre support rail seated, every bolt torqued, slats and slat holders set so nothing creaks

  • Sofa bed frame and mechanism

    £85 – £145

    1 hr 45 mins

    Mechanism cycled through its full travel, feet levelled, arms and back squared to the base

  • Divan base with headboard fitting

    £55 – £95

    1 hr

    Halves joined and clipped, castors or glides fitted, headboard struts set to your mattress height

  • Day bed or trundle

    £65 – £110

    1 hr 15 mins

    Trundle rollers set to clear the skirting, back and side rails squared so the frame sits flat

  • Upholstered bed frame

    £75 – £125

    1 hr 30 mins

    Fabric panels handled clean, bolt covers refitted, headboard bolted plumb to the base

  • Headboard fitting only

    £35 – £55

    30 mins

    Bolted or wall-fixed level, packers used where the skirting throws the board off plumb

Scope

What is included in Knightsbridge

Every Knightsbridge SW1 booking includes the left-hand list. The right is work that belongs to a separate booking or a registered trade — we say so before you book, not on the day.

Included in every visit

  • Every frame on your Knightsbridge list built in the room it is staying in, squared and levelled to the floor you have
  • Centre support rails and legs seated properly, slats and slat holders set so the frame does not creak
  • Every bolt torqued in sequence, then re-checked once the slats and mattress are in place
  • Safety checks on bunks, sleepers and cots against BS EN 747 and BS EN 716 — the ottoman lifted and held loaded, strut rating matched to the mattress weight and the lift travel checked against the window
  • Westminster City Council permits or bay suspensions where SW1 needs one
  • Flattened cardboard, polystyrene and strapping taken away in the van

Not included — and why

  • Mattress supply and delivery — we build around the mattress you have ordered rather than selling you one
  • Wall-fixed headboards into a wall that needs new structure or a stud repair first (we will quote that as handyman work)
  • Manufacturer spare parts: missing bolts, cams or damaged panels are photographed and ordered at cost with the receipt
  • Removal of an old bed, which is quoted alongside the build and carried out under our waste carrier licence
  • Electrical work on an adjustable base beyond plugging it in, which belongs to a registered electrician
